December 17, 2014 - Aroma: A raw agave nose with hints of citrus and vegetal notes.
Initial Taste: The earthy agave notes are present right off the bat. The vegetal sweetness is there as well.
Body: A nice mouthfeel with an oily body. The agave/peppery notes combine with the earth to make for a really potent flavor.
Finish: A long finish with a nice mix of earthy agave and pepper linger. Just the hints of vegetal and sours notes hang around as well to make it interesting.
For the money, this is a great buy. Big and bold flavors with a real vegetal and earthy agave presence. With the Rudo & Tecnico lines, they created a little something for everyone. Rudo for the earth/gritty/peppery tequila fans and Tecnico will satisfy those looking for a sweet after dinner sipper. What it tells me is that the people behind this brand know how to craft a tequila from start to finish. If you see the NOM 1467 on the label, you can expect good things...just make sure that you do your research ahead of time. Salud!
